Intergovernmental Information Systems Advisory Council

Also known as:
Intergovernmental Information Services Advisory Council
IISAC
Active dates:1971-2000
Function:

The advisory council will: assist the commissioner of administration in development and updating of intergovernmental information systems master plan; recommend policies and procedures governing collections, security, and confidentiality of data; review and comment on applications for information systems and computer systems involving intergovernmental funding; liaison with local government; develop recommendations to commissioner of revenue concerning gathering and reporting of certain data collected from local units of government; and produce fiscal information and foster efficient use of resources.

History:

The council was created by the Legislature in 1971, and was originally codified in Minn. Stat. 16.911. A few changes were made to the council over the course of the 1970s. In 1984, the Legislature recodified the council at Minn. Stat. 16B.42. Additional incremental changes were made in the 1980s and 1990s. The council expired on June 30, 2000.

Membership:

When the council was originally created in 1971, statute did not specify council membership.

As of 1999, just prior to its expiration, the council was composed of:

  • two members from each of the following groups: counties outside of the seven-county metropolitan area, cities of the second and third class outside the metropolitan area, cities of the second and third class within the metropolitan area, and cities of the fourth class; 
  • one member from each of the following groups: the metropolitan council, an outstate regional body, counties within the metropolitan area, cities of the first class, school districts in the metropolitan area, school districts outside the metropolitan area, and public libraries;
  • one member each appointed by the state departments of children, families, and learning, human services, revenue, and economic security, the office of strategic and long-range planning, administration, and the legislative auditor;
  • one member from the office of the state auditor, appointed by the auditor;
  • one member appointed by each of the following organizations: League of Minnesota Cities, Association of Minnesota Counties, Minnesota Association of Township Officers, and Minnesota Association of School Administrators; and
  • one member of the house of representatives appointed by the speaker and one member of the senate appointed by the subcommittee on committees of the committee on rules and administration
